ER図メーカー ER図
データベースのエンティティとリレーションシップを説明するだけで、AIがプロ品質のER図を瞬時に生成します。データベース設計・ソフトウェアエンジニアリング・学術課題に最適です。
ER図ジェネレーター
By using ConceptViz, you agree not to generate or edit adult, sexual, explicit, unsafe, or policy-violating content. See Content Policy.
無料で試す ·
ER図がここに表示されます
データベース構造を説明して「生成」をクリックしてください
ER図のサンプル
さまざまな分野のサンプルを閲覧するか、上記で独自のER図を生成してください
大学データベースERD
リレーションシップにひし形、属性に楕円形を使ったChen記法による大学入学システムのプロ品質ER図。
病院管理システムERD
一対多・多対多のリレーションシップを示したクロウズフット記法の詳細な病院管理ERD。
ECサイトデータベースERD
エンティティごとに異なる色を使ったChen記法によるECプラットフォームの見やすいERD。
図書館管理システムERD
貸し出しとカタログ管理のリレーションシップを示したクロウズフット記法の図書館ERD。
SNSプラットフォームERD
多対多・自己参照リレーションシップを含む複雑なSNSプラットフォームERD。
在庫管理システムERD
調達・流通の明確なカーディナリティラベルを持つ在庫・サプライチェーン管理ERD。
ER図とは?
ER図(実体関連図)は、システムのデータモデルを視覚的に表現する構造図です。エンティティ(オブジェクトや概念)・属性(プロパティ)・エンティティ間のリレーションシップを示します。1976年にPeter Chenによって提唱されたER図は、データベース設計の標準ツールとなり、開発者・アナリスト・研究者がリレーショナルデータベースの構造を実装前に計画・共有するために広く活用されています。
ER図の種類:概念・論理・物理
ER図には3つの抽象化レベルがあります。概念ER図は技術的な詳細を省いたエンティティとリレーションシップの概要を提供し、ステークホルダーとのコミュニケーションに最適です。論理ER図は属性・主キー・カーディナリティ制約を加えつつもデータベース非依存の形式を保ちます。物理ER図はデータ型・インデックス・テーブル構造など特定のデータベース管理システムに合わせた実装詳細を含みます。各レベルは異なる対象者と設計フェーズのニーズに対応しています。
ER図を使う場面
- アプリケーションや研究プロジェクト向けに新しいリレーショナルデータベースを設計する場合
- チームのオンボーディングや知識移転のために既存データベース構造を文書化する場合
- 明確なビジュアル参照を使ってデータベース移行やスキーマのリファクタリングを計画する場合
- 開発者・アナリスト・ビジネスステークホルダー間でデータ要件を伝達する場合
- データベース管理・ソフトウェアエンジニアリング・情報システムの学術課題として
- 構造化データ収集・分析を含む研究のデータモデリングとして
ER図記法ガイド:Chen記法 vs クロウズフット記法 vs UML
ER図には3つの主要な記法があります。オリジナルの標準であるChen記法はエンティティに四角形・リレーションシップにひし形・属性に楕円形を使用し、学習や学術用途に最も直感的です。クロウズフット記法(IE記法とも呼ばれる)はカーディナリティ(一対一・一対多・多対多)を示すフォーク状の記号付き線を使用し、業界では最も普及しています。UMLクラス図記法は属性・メソッドのコンパートメントを持つボックスを使用し、オブジェクト指向設計でよく使われます。当ジェネレーターはすべての主要な記法スタイルに対応しています。
ER図を使ったデータベース設計のベストプラクティス
- 詳細を加える前に、高レベルのエンティティとリレーションシップを把握するための概念モデルから始める
- データの冗長性を排除するために少なくとも第三正規形(3NF)まで正規化する
- すべてのエンティティに明確な主キーを定義し、外部キーを使ってリレーションシップを確立する
- 図全体でエンティティ・属性・リレーションシップの命名規則を統一する
- すべてのリレーションシップのカーディナリティと参加制約(全体 vs 部分)を文書化する
- 物理実装に進む前にステークホルダーとER図をレビュー・検証する


